One option is to use the Symbolic Math Toolbox and go from there.
Example —
syms t
u(t) = heaviside(t);
X(t)=(t+1)*u(t-1)-t*u(t)-u(t-2)
X(t) = 
figure
fplot(X, [-1 3])
grid
ylim(1.5*ylim)
That only required copying and pasting the function and adding some necessary multiplication operators before plotting it.
